How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Enatai?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Enatai Studio Apartments | $2,220 | $1,200 | $4,437 |
| Enatai 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,030 | $1,275 | $8,900 |
| Enatai 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,933 | $1,896 | $10,000+ |
| Enatai 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,965 | $2,644 | $10,000+ |
| Enatai 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,503 | $4,452 | $10,000+ |
